Artex is a great way to brighten up dull flat ceilings.

Many different patterns can be easily achieved these days by using inexpensive tools, the comb and stipple brush are 2 of the cheapest and can be used to give a variety of different finishes. Special rollers are also available to give more complicated patterns.

Artex / textured finish is available ready mixed or in powder. The bags of powder are so cheap, from £9 for 25 kg, this is enough for a few ceilings. The mix has to be right though, not too thick or too watery. For anyone new to it it's best to practice on an old peice of plasterboard to get used to handling it and decide on what pattern you will use. Once mixed it can be applied by brush or floated onto the ceiling before doing the pattern.

With a little practice you can transform your ceilings for little cost.
